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Game Rights on Mayo Estates.

31.

asked the Minister for Lands if the Land Commission own the game rights in the former estates of Lucan 1, 2, 3 and 4, E. M. Kelly, Blosse-Lynch, Hope-Scott, Peyton, Mark Blake, Moore 1 and 2, Fitzgerald-Kenney, Marquis of Sligo 1 and 2, Tuohy, Pringle and Acton and Ormsby; in what cases the game rights were retained by the landlord; and if he will state the names and addresses of the tenants (if any) to whom the game rights have transferred on vesting.

The question relates to 18 very large properties which were mostly dealt with many years ago by the former Congested Districts Board. The current records do not enable a comprehensive reply to be readily given. Indeed, so many thousands of tenants are involved that it would be quite impracticable to give comprehensive information by way of parliamentary reply.

If the Deputy is interested in any particular townlands, I shall ask the Land Commission to send him the appropriate information.

Is information available with regard to the game rights vested in the Land Commission when these estates were taken over?

In the case of many of them, they were vested in the Land Commission. In the case of others, on revesting, they were vested in the tenants.

If the Minister has that information, that is all I want to know.

It would be difficult to state them without referring to an examination of something like 4,000 tenants. If the Deputy desires any specific information, he might frame a question to that effect, or go to the Land Commission, where the records will be made available.
